Default Dumping the wastegate on a inline pro kit...

hey guys, well I'm thinking more and more about a inline pro turbo kit than a CTSC. Just that I have more room late down the road after I finish my school stuff and get a real job.

Anyways, A few of my friends in the Nissan crowd have piece their own turbo setups. One thing that I have always loved about their setup is that they run a dump pipe from the wastegate down to the ground. And when they go WOT and when they shift a gear it makes a WAAAAAAAAPPP sound. So sick, lol. One of them is just around 250-275 whp and my other friend was at close to 400-500whp. The sound isn't that much different.

So I just wanted to know if with the inline pro kit if I'll would be able to fab up a pipe from the outlet wastgate to the ground and close up the pipe that leads to the downpipe. I haven't seen any pictures of the kit out unstalled to get a clear answer... Thanks guy.

inline pros kit does vent to the atmosphere and gives you that waaaaaaaaaaaaaappppppppppp sound your talking about
there wastegate does not go into the downpipe
